在电竞行业快速发展的背景下,Dota2作为国际知名的电子竞技项目,吸引了大量观众和投注者。随着竞猜市场规模的扩大,竞猜结算的准确性与公正性成为行业关注的焦点。然而,偶尔出现的结算错误不仅影响用户体验,也会损害平台信誉。本文将深入分析Dota2竞猜结算错误的技术原因以及相应的保障机制,旨在为相关行业提供有益的借鉴与指导。

竞猜结算错误的核心技术因素
首先,竞猜结算的复杂性使得系统面临多重技术挑战。在比赛数据传输环节,延迟和数据丢失极易导致结算信息的不准确。例如,比赛数据源可能因网络不稳定或平台接口问题出现延误,导致竞猜结果与实际比赛情况不符。以某次案例为例,比赛数据在传输过程中发生了短暂断线,导致系统未能及时更新比分信息,从而引发了几千美元的资金结算差错。
其次,算法处理环节的缺陷也可能引发错误。结算系统通常依赖复杂的程序逻辑来判断比赛结果,若该算法未准确应对特殊情况,比如比赛中途暂停或出现异常操作,就会造成判定偏差。此外,版本更新或代码漏洞也可能在无意中引入逻辑缺陷,影响竞猜结果的准确输出。
再者,系统同时承载大量用户并发请求,在高并发情况下,服务器负载过重容易引发数据同步错误。高峰时期,假如基础架构没有有效的负载均衡和容错机制,就可能导致部分用户的结算信息被延迟或重复处理,最终出现资金结算出错。
保障机制的构建与优化
为了预防和减少竞猜结算错误的发生,行业内不断探索和完善多层次的保障机制。首先,采用多重数据校验技术,确保比赛数据在传输和存储过程中的完整性与实时性。例如,可通过分布式数据库同步、多次确认机制等手段,减少数据出错率。
其次,引入第三方权威数据供应商,可以显